Removal of a reactive textile dye by CaO2-based oxidation process

The adoption of environmentally friendly practices in removing textile dye-containing wastewater through advanced oxidation processes is crucial for ecological and environmental health. Calcium peroxide (CaO2) stands out as an environmentally friendly oxidant with potent oxidizing capabilities. Examining CaO2's potential in oxidizing textile dyes in wastewater can advance the proliferation of eco-friendly treatment methods. This study investigates the efficacy of Direct-CaO2, UV/CaO2, Fe2+/CaO2, and UV/Fe2+/CaO2 processes in oxidizing RB222 textile dye. Optimal conditions for these processes were determined, revealing CaO2 dosage as the most influential independent variable. At a pH of 10 and with 1.0 g CaO2 dosage, CaO2 and UV/CaO2 processes achieved color removal efficiencies of 79.80% (180 min) and 90.40% (120 min), respectively, for 100 mg/L RB222. The optimum pH and Fe2+/CaO2 ratio for Fe2+/CaO2 and UV/Fe2+/CaO2 processes were determined as 2.50 and 0.40, respectively. Under these conditions, Fe2+/CaO2 achieved complete color removal in 40 minutes with 0.125 g CaO2, while UV/Fe2+/CaO2 accomplished the same in 10 minutes with 0.0625 g CaO2. Anions such as Cl-, SO42-, and PO43- were found to have adverse effects on RB222 oxidation. Thermodynamic analyses indicated that oxidation reactions were endothermic across all processes. Studies utilizing CaO2 demonstrated its high potential for RB222 removal. These findings are expected to significantly benefit the treatment of dye-containing wastewater, offering an effective and environmentally friendly approach. Keywords: Textile Dye, CaO2, Oxidation
